Details
A vulnerability was found in IBM WebSphere MQ up to 7.4 (Application Server Software). It has been classified as problematic. This affects an unknown part.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a path traversal v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-22. The product uses external input to construct a pathname that is intended to identify a file or directory that is located underneath a restricted parent directory, but the product does not properly neutralize special elements within the pathname that can cause the pathname to resolve to a location that is outside of the restricted directory.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ality. The summary by CVE is:
Directory traversal vulnerability in WMQ Telemetry in IBM WebSphere MQ 7.5 before 7.5.0.3 allows remote attackers to read arbitrary files via a crafted URI.
The weakness was shared 03/01/2014 (Website). The advisory is shared at xforce.iss.net. This vulnerability is uniquely identified as CVE-2013-4054 since 06/07/2013.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. No form of authentication is needed for exploitation. Neither technical details nor an exploit are publicly available. MITRE ATT&CK project uses the attack technique T1006 for this issue.
The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 73103 (IBM WebSphere MQ 7.1 < 7.1.0.5 / 7.5 < 7.5.0.3 Multiple Vulnerabilities),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ment. It is assigned to the family Windows.
Upgrading to version 7.5 eliminates this vulnerability.
